Output 29a196efd6c40283230426125a349e419387e2fa17ae500b1a0d5d419f2aa698:2

value
68625000
script pubkey
OP_0 OP_PUSHBYTES_20 3e11a512456af3e5c35bc21865dbe76ea8a42f04
address
bc1q8cg62yj9dte7ts6mcgvxtkl8d652gtcy5ww6xl
transaction
29a196efd6c40283230426125a349e419387e2fa17ae500b1a0d5d419f2aa698
spent
true